Man cited for vandalism at park and ride in Enosburgh

1 min read

ENOSBURGH — Vermont State Police cited a 23-year-old Sheldon man for unlawful mischief after he allegedly damaged another vehicle at the Enosburgh Park and Ride on July 13.

Police said they received a late report of vandalism that occurred at approximately 12:37 p.m. at the park and ride facility.

Investigation revealed that Gage Hogaboom purposely damaged a vehicle belonging to Kaylie Richardson, 19, of St. Albans, according to police.

Hogaboom was issued a citation to appear in Franklin County Superior Court on Oct. 28 at 8:30 a.m. to answer the unlawful mischief charge.
